Output 9066e289b90208a0550decf1d41b83ba728456d4ea170eeb8af6f84ceb1e53d1:1

value
766605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14f584f4682edc2ddecc660569eb09292b108e83 OP_EQUALVERIFY OP_CHECKSIG
address
12updpasRWRXPjBSSHAvbThyiKedRxzEqm
transaction
9066e289b90208a0550decf1d41b83ba728456d4ea170eeb8af6f84ceb1e53d1
spent
true